If you can peel your eyes off the cover to actually read the book you won't regret it. The story is short enough to not bore you and long enough to get a great, well-written story packed with amazing characters and great story-line as well.
Holden works for his dad in a prestigious surgical company with an open budget for his testing, though his dad holds power over him by flaunting the loan he owes him and taking most of his pay to pay him back. He sends him to Alaska on an impossible mission to Bring back Gage his ex-partner or he will be fired, lose his apartment and trust fund. With no choice, he goes to Alaska and Gage is more than he expected.
Gage has a good reason he left the company he helped build to come to Alaska where his best friend Logan and he works at the community hospital in Sawyers Ferry, a remote island you can only reach by boat or air. He is now happy except for the fact that finding a man is pretty much out of the question and he doesn't do hookups anyhow. In waltz Holden, young and gorgeous and a pain in the backside ( not in a good way).
I loved the instant dynamics between these two men. Gage adamant he doesn't want to hear what Preston has to say and Holden not taking no for an answer until he listens. It's funny how he looks like a stalker and there is some cute comment back and forth. Then Holden gets stranded in Gage's driveway. In blizzard. Gage finally gives in feeling sorry and invites him in with strict rules... he can't watch him sleep and he can't speak. I couldn't help but laugh out loud at the banter, then Holden asks if he is sure he doesn't want to hear.. Gage says nothing will make him go back and Holden takes off his shirt and plops in his lap. Let the sexy times begin!
Gage has a best friend Logan that is awesome and intriguing and Holden has a best friend Frankie that steals some page time. I love Frankie and really want to see his story! The setting is awesome and well done without a lot of just describing backdrops. Cate Ashwood paints the picture in action s. The storyline is good and there is some nailbiting action scenes at the hospital and a twist at the end that left my mouth gaping. The sex is hot and just enough to enhance the story. I didn't skim a line! The epilogue left me swooning.
Now...I need Logan and Frankie's story ( not necessarily together!) I could read two ( or more) books in this series right away, please!
Cate discovered her love for books of all kinds early on, but romance is where her heart truly lies. She is addicted to the happily ever afters and the journey the characters take to get there. Currently residing in White Rock, B.C, Cate loves living just a stone's throw from the ocean. When she's not writing, she can be found consuming coffee at an alarming rate while wrangling her toddler, her husband, and their two cats.
